Geographic Location of Ghoghra


The village Ghoghra is located in Batouli Tahsil of Surguja District in the State of Chhattisgarh in India. It is governed by Ghoghra Gram Panchayat. It comes under Batauli Community Development Block. The nearest town is Ambikapur, which is about 35 kilometers away from Ghoghra.

Social Structure of Ghoghra


As per available data from the year 2009, 1856 persons live in 408 house holds in the village Ghoghra. There are 954 female individuals and 902 male individuals in the village. Females constitute 51.4% and males constitute 48.6% of the total population.

There are 1606 scheduled tribes persons of which 826 are females and 780 are males. Females constitute 51.43% and males constitute 48.57% of the scheduled tribes population. Scheduled tribes constitute 86.53% of the total population.

Population density of Ghoghra is 144.66 persons per square kilometer.

Total area of Ghoghra is 1282.98 Hectares as per the data available for the year 2009.

Total sown/agricultural area is 578.46 ha. About 464.46 ha is un-irrigated area. About 114 ha is irrigated area. About 111.13 ha is irrigated by canal water. About 0.47 ha is irrigated by wells/tube wells. About 2.4 ha is irrigated by other sources of water.

About 60.56 ha is in non-agricultural use. About 163.82 ha is used permanent pastures and grazing lands. About 1.63 ha is under miscellaneous tree crops.

About 36.24 ha is lying as current fallow area. About 380.9 ha is culturable waste land. About 40.3 ha is lying as fallow land other than current fallows.
